A PAIR OF MEISSEN FIGURES OF MALABARS modelled by J.F. Eberlein, he in yellow hat, fur-lined sleeveless coat, fur-lined sleeveless undercoat and yellow trousers, standing leaning on his silvered shield, carrying a sword suspended from his waist and a quiver of arrows on his back, his companion in pale-yellow hat, fur-lined cloak, green jacket with a yellow collar tied with a puce-striped cummerbund and puce flowered yellow skirt, standing carrying a basket of fruit in her right arm and a covered basket in her left hand, on square bases (restoration to his neck and right fingers, end of sword lacking, cracks about shield, chips to hat and restored chip to edge of jacket, she extensively damaged, repaired, handle of covered basket lacking), traces of blue crossed swords mark on female figure, circa 1750

36.5cm. and 36cm. high (2)
Provenance
Collection Girtanner/Dobay, Sale 9-19 December 1926, lots 150/151
Exhibited
Schonheit des 18 Jahrhunderts Kunsthaus, Zürich, 1955, no. P84
